Susan L. Zultanski is a scholar working on Organic Chemistry, Molecular Biology and Inorganic Chemistry. According to data from OpenAlex, Susan L. Zultanski has authored 15 papers receiving a total of 1.8k ind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Organic Chemistry, 5 papers in Molecular Biology and 3 papers in Inorganic Chemistry. Recurrent topics in Susan L. Zultanski’s work include Catalytic C–H Functionalization Methods (9 papers), Radical Photochemical Reactions (6 papers) and Chemical Synthesis and Analysis (4 papers). Susan L. Zultanski is often cited by papers focused on Catalytic C–H Functionalization Methods (9 papers), Radical Photochemical Reactions (6 papers) and Chemical Synthesis and Analysis (4 papers). Susan L. Zultanski collaborates with scholars based in United States. Susan L. Zultanski's co-authors include Gregory C. Fu, Agnieszka Bartoszewicz, Carson D. Matier, Quirin M. Kainz, Jonas C. Peters, Shannon S. Stahl, Jacob H. Waldman, Feng Peng, Michael Shevlin and Yong‐Li Zhong and has published in prestigious journals such as Science, Journal of the American Chemical Society and ACS Catalysis.
